On Thu, 8 Aug 2019 at 06:09, Phil Hord <[email protected]> wrote:
> I have a repo with 24,000 tags, most of which are not useful to any
> developers. Having this many refs slows down many operations that
> would otherwise be very fast. Removing these tags when they've been
> accidentally fetched again takes about 30 minutes using delete_ref.
>
> git tag -l feature/* | xargs git tag -d
>
> Removing the same tags using delete_refs takes less than 5 seconds.
This looks worthwhile pursuing...

If any tag is non-existing (or some other error happens here), we don't
continue to the actual deleting. That breaks t7004 which has a test for
removing an existing and a non-existing tag -- it wants the existing one
to be removed and the non-existing one not to interfere.
> + if (!result)
> + result = delete_refs(NULL, &ref_list, REF_NO_DEREF);
So this should perhaps be something more like an unconditional
result |= delete_refs(...);
That makes the test suite happy, but perhaps only short-term ... See
below...
